This Flipboard magazine, curated by Mark Lenzi (The Wonderful World of Wine), contains a roundup of 14 stories focused on the beverage and liquor industry.
The main highlighted stories include a mix of industry retrospectives, product guides, travel features, and archeological discoveries:
- The 15 Beers That Defined American Craft Brewing — and Where They Are Now (from VinePair): Written by Aaron Goldfarb, this retrospective covers the evolution of the American craft beer movement. It looks back at the foundational beers that challenged "Big Beer" lagers and tracks what has happened to those classic brews today.
- The 10 Best High-Proof Tequilas (from VinePair): A guide by Stephen Bradley breaking down top-tier, high-proof tequilas. The piece notes how consumer perceptions of tequila have shifted, highlighting how the spirit is moving beyond its "party drink" reputation into a more appreciated, complex category.
- You Have to Ride This Beautiful Wine Train in Napa, California (from Time Out): A travel and experience piece by Erika Mailman highlighting the Napa Valley Wine Train, detailing how it successfully pairs vintage train travel with premium California wine tastings.
- Oldest Wine in the World Is Still Liquid Inside 2,000-Year-Old Roman Funeral Urn (from ZME Science): A fascinating historical piece by Tibi Puiu covering an archeological discovery where liquid wine was found remarkably preserved inside an ancient Roman tomb's funeral urn.
The collection as a whole is designed to bridge the gap between casual beverage lovers and industry insiders, touching on beer, spirits, wine culture, and history.
